Finer print:
*A 'stay' is defined as consecutive nights spent at the same hotel, regardless of check-in/check-out activity.
Registration is required. Marriott Rewards, Starwood Preferred Guest, and The Ritz-Carlton Rewards (“Loyalty Program”) members who register for this promotion by January 7, 2019 will earn 2,000 bonus points per stay on stays of 2 or more nights at participating brands. Plus, members can earn an additional 1,000 bonus points per brand starting with the second brand at which the member stays during the promotion earning period. The promotion earning period is for stays between September 26, 2018 and January 31, 2019, at participating Marriott Rewards, SPG and Ritz-Carlton properties. A 'stay' is defined as consecutive nights spent at the same hotel, regardless of check-in/check-out activity. Rooms booked through most third party online retailers and select travel agency bookings are ineligible to earn for this promotion. The member receiving this offer has been targeted and the offer is not transferable. Bonus points will be awarded to the member’s account up to six weeks after the promotion ends. Marriott Vacation Club® owner-occupied weeks are not eligible for bonus points and nights spent while redeeming an award are not eligible for bonus points. Only one room per hotel is counted toward a member’s nights or stay. Members electing to earn miles are not eligible for this promotion. Clarification from Starwood Lurker in post 125:
- In regards to the part of the offer where you can earn 1,000 points for trying a new brand…There is no minimum length of stay, but you only earn it starting with the second brand. So if you only stay at one brand during the promo period, you will not earn this bonus. But if you stay at 2 or more brands, you will earn 1,000 points for each of those brands after the first one even if the stay is only one night.
- You earn on every stay of 2+ nights, so it isn’t about accumulating nights. If you have two stays of 1 night each, you will not earn a bonus. If you have two accounts, you may register for MegaBonus with either or both accounts. You will only be able to earn with one account at a time because you will earn the bonus points in whichever account the stay was booked with. Example: If you have two accounts that are not combined: If you register for MegaBonus with your SPG number and stay with your SPG number, you will earn the bonus points in your SPG account. If you register for MegaBonus with your SPG number but book your stay with your MR number, you will not earn bonus points.
